    Bella Coola Road (Highway 20) spans 454 km (282 miles), running east-west from Williams Lake in the Central Interior of British Columbia to Bella Coola in the Bella Coola Valley. It's an amazingly scenic trip, but be prepared for gravel roads and steep grades. Also known as the Chilcotin Highway, it links the Central Coast with the Central Interior...

    The drive can be nerve-wracking, featuring both paved and unpaved sections. It’s paved for the first 319 km to Anahim Lake. Then, it transitions to an all-season gravel road. The road is not for the faint of heart. Driving in low gears and fully concentrating on the road is necessary when navigating the hair-pinned killer curves. It's such a white-...

    The road is very challenging, including 11 km of switchbacks on the way up to Heckman Pass, nicknamed as The Hill, at 1,524 m (5,000 ft) above sea level. The road descends 43 km (27 mi) of steep, narrow road with sharp hairpin turns and two major switchbacks to the Bella Coola Valley.     The road was completed in 1953. With only two bulldozers starting from opposite ends, supplies bought on credit, and a labor force that only had the promise of being paid, they clawed their own way up and out of the valley.The work took one year and two weeks to complete.
